The lake level is 553.37 and has been the same for over 2-weeks with no discharge except for minimum flow. The White River at Newport is 3.41 feet and very low but they have started to generate heavily on Bull Shoals but also on Table Rock filling Bull Shoals back up. Table Rock has been the only lake that they keep several feet below power pool and drawing it down in the winter to prevent Branson Landing from flooding in the spring. They tried letting that happen once and got so much blow back that they will not let that happen again. Bull Shoals and Norfork do not matter. It is all about the $. I would like to see Norfork at about 548 going into the spring. Both generators are still inoperable. The surface water tmeperature is 62-63 degrees and the water is fairly clear and you can see your lure down 5-6 feet in the sunshine. The creeks are still satined a bit but not bad. Fishing is still not the best with a few of about everything being caught. Brush piles are producing a few Crappie, Bass and several Bluegill. A few Temperate Bass are biting spoons in open water on shad and a few walleye are coming to the bank to feed on shadowy banks at sunset. Nothing is on fire, in a feeding frenzy, biting heavily or hammering anything but a few are being caught everyday if you work at it. It is definitely tough in the day time in the sunshine. I am doing the best right at sunset but the ambient temperature cools off fast. The best bet for striper fishermen is just before the full moon which is the 27th. The weather remains nice with not much chance of rain until Sunday evening.
